🔥 Breaking News: A recent North Carolina Court of Appeals decision has cast uncertainty over the 2024 State Supreme Court election. The court ruled in favor of Republican candidate Jefferson Griffin, potentially invalidating over 60,000 ballots and jeopardizing Democratic Justice Allison Riggs' narrow 734-vote lead.
